CareCloud, Inc. (NASDAQ:CCLD – Get Free Report) saw a large drop in short interest during the month of March. As of March 31st, there was short interest totaling 574,922 shares, a drop of 26.7% from the March 15th total of 784,771 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 784,693 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 0.7 days. Currently, 1.6% of the shares of the company are short sold.

About CareCloud
CareCloud, Inc is a healthcare technology company that provides cloud-based practice management, electronic health record (EHR) and revenue cycle management (RCM) solutions to medical practices and health systems. Its flagship offering, the CareCloud Central platform, combines clinical, financial and administrative workflows into a single, unified system. The platform includes modules for scheduling, billing, coding, patient engagement and telehealth, enabling practices to streamline front- and back-office operations and improve overall practice performance.
Founded in 2009 and headquartered in Miami Beach, Florida, CareCloud serves small to mid-size physician groups and specialty clinics across the United States.
